PMD Forecasts Rain, Storms Across Balochistan

The Pakistan Meteorological Department (PMD) has forecasted thunderstorms, rain, and strong winds in several cities this evening. Most areas in Balochistan will see cloudy weather on Monday, while Quetta, Ziarat, Chaman, Mastung and Pishin may experience rain with thunder and snowfall in the mountains. Strong winds and thunderstorms are also expected in Chaghi, Nushki, Khuzdar, Barkhan, Sibi, Hernai, Zhob and Musa Khel.

Minimum temperatures in various regions were recorded as 7°C in Quetta, 5°C in Kalat, 3°C in Ziarat, 9°C in Zhob, 14°C in Sibi, 19°C in Turbat, 15°C in Nokundi and 12°C in Chaman. In coastal areas, Gwadar recorded 18°C, while Jiwani was at 19°C. The weather system responsible for these changes is expected to enter Pakistan through Balochistan today.

PMD has also forecasted strong winds and rain in most Punjab districts from February 25 to March 1, with snow and rain likely in Murree and Galyat. Over the weekend, Murree attracted a large number of tourists eager to experience its snow-covered landscapes. Visitors faced traffic congestion as cars, buses, and motorcycles filled the roads leading to the hill station.

Murree’s frosty scenery, frozen lakes, and valleys captivated tourists. A student from Islamabad, visiting with friends, shared, “I had been waiting for this trip for weeks.”
